I have successfully installed FreeBSD/386 on my Toshiba laptop
Satellite Pro 410CS (phew!$^$%!).  It was actually rather easy but a
slight pain.  I had to do the install from a DOS/Windows95 partition.
I didn't have enough space so I could only do an initial install.  Now
I have more space and want to install additional components but I can't
get it to work.

I am executing /stand/sysinstall to attempt this.  My first attempt
was to try to get gateD to install.  I still don't have enough space
to copy the entire CD-ROM onto my DOS/WIN partition.  What files do I
need to copy over to the DOS/WIN partition to get this install to
work.  I will be trying to install other components so I need to do
the same thing for them too.
